Maine to Vermont Road Trip Overview
This road trip is a scenic journey through some of the most beautiful parts of New England, blending coastal charm, outdoor adventure, small-town character, and vibrant city life. Begin in Portland, Maine, where you can enjoy a lively waterfront, historic streets, and excellent seafood before heading to Boothbay Harbor for a quieter seaside atmosphere. Continue north to Acadia National Park, one of the most breathtaking natural destinations in the region, with rugged shorelines, mountain views, and memorable hikes.
After exploring Maine’s coast and national park landscapes, travel west to Camden and Bar Harbor for more classic New England scenery, harbor views, and relaxed local culture. From there, cross into Vermont and experience Burlington’s energetic lakefront, then head to Stowe for mountain scenery and outdoor recreation. Waterbury adds a fun stop for local food and craft beverages, while Grafton offers a peaceful, historic village setting to end the trip on a calm note. Together, these destinations create a balanced itinerary filled with nature, charm, and memorable stops along the way.
